It would be great to have only one TCP/IP connection opened between
an EJB client and the EJB server and this across multiple requests.
My understanding is that at the moment a TCP/IP connection is
negotiated for each EJB request which is very expensive especially
based on the rather small size of the payload being passed back and
forth over TCP/IP.
Definitely agree it's something to look into. I had thought about
that, but got focussed on getting this guy past his immediate problem.
